Oboeist Louis Baumann in concert in Lembach

The Saint-Jacques church in Lembach will welcome oboist Louis Baumann this Sunday, October 13, for a concert which will begin at 5 p.m.

Louis Baumann began playing the oboe with Christophe Le Divenah at the music school. From a young age, he expressed the desire to play in an orchestra. His very first musical experience was at the Musique Union in Preuschdorf.

Principal oboe at the Antwerp Symphony Orchestra

Louis joined Sébastien Giot’s class at the conservatory where he obtained his diploma in musical studies (DEM). After a stint in the region in the class of Hélène Devilleneuve then Johannes Grosso, he was admitted in 2015 to the National Conservatory of Music in in the class of Jean-Louis Capezzali and Jérôme Guichard. Upon graduation, in 2018 he joined the Zurich Opera Academy for two seasons under the mentorship of Bernhard Henrichs and Clément Noël.

At the end of 2019, Louis Baumann was appointed, through competition, principal English horn at the National Orchestra and then, immediately, principal oboe within the Antwerp Symphony Orchestra, a position he currently holds. In October 2021, he won the 3e ex aequo prize in the Geneva international competition. He is a regular guest of the Rotterdam Philharmonic Orchestra, the Mahler Chamber Orchestra and other groups of excellence in Europe.
Sunday October 13, 5 p.m., Saint-Jacques church in Lembach. Free entry, plateau for the benefit of the renovation of the Calvary.
